Buying Guide
When it comes to buying tattoo aftercare products, there are a few important factors to consider. We’ve compiled a list of features to look for in order to help you choose the best product for your needs.
Ingredients
The ingredients in a tattoo aftercare product are crucial to its effectiveness. Look for products that contain natural and gentle ingredients such as aloe vera, coconut oil, and shea butter. Avoid products that contain harsh chemicals or fragrances that could irritate your skin.
Application
Consider how easy the product is to apply and how often it needs to be applied. Look for products that come in convenient packaging and are easy to apply, such as a roll-on or spray. Also, consider how often the product needs to be applied. Some products require multiple applications per day, while others only need to be applied once.
Healing Properties
The primary purpose of a tattoo aftercare product is to help your tattoo heal properly. Look for products that contain ingredients that promote healing, such as vitamin E and tea tree oil. These ingredients can help reduce inflammation and prevent infection.
Price
Price is always a consideration when buying any product. However, don’t sacrifice quality for a lower price. Look for products that offer a good balance of quality and affordability.
Brand Reputation
Consider the reputation of the brand before making a purchase. Look for brands that have a good reputation for producing high-quality tattoo aftercare products. Read reviews and ask for recommendations from your tattoo artist or friends who have experience with tattoos.
By considering these factors, you can choose a tattoo aftercare product that will help your tattoo heal properly and keep it looking great for years to come.

What are the essential steps for tattoo aftercare within the first 48 hours?
During the first 48 hours after getting a tattoo, it is crucial to keep the area clean and protected. We recommend gently washing the tattoo with mild soap and warm water, patting it dry with a clean towel, and applying a thin layer of recommended ointment. It’s also important to avoid exposing the tattoo to direct sunlight, soaking it in water, or scratching or picking at the scabs.
Which tattoo aftercare products are recommended by experts?
There are many tattoo aftercare products available on the market, but not all of them are created equal. We recommend using a fragrance-free, gentle soap, a non-scented, non-petroleum-based moisturizer, and a recommended ointment that contains vitamins A and D. It’s important to avoid using products that contain alcohol, fragrances, or harsh chemicals.
How should I care for my tattoo during the first week of healing?
During the first week of healing, it’s important to continue keeping the tattoo clean and protected. We recommend washing the tattoo gently with mild soap and warm water twice a day, patting it dry with a clean towel, and applying a thin layer of recommended ointment. It’s also important to avoid exposing the tattoo to direct sunlight, soaking it in water, or scratching or picking at the scabs.
What are the best practices for daily tattoo aftercare?
To ensure proper healing and long-term preservation of your tattoo, it’s important to follow a few best practices for daily aftercare. We recommend avoiding tight clothing or anything that may rub against the tattoo, keeping the area clean and dry, and applying a recommended moisturizer as needed. It’s also important to avoid exposing the tattoo to direct sunlight and to use sunscreen when necessary.
Which ointment is considered the most effective for new tattoo care?
There are many ointments available for new tattoo care, but the most effective ones typically contain vitamins A and D and are fragrance-free. We recommend consulting with your tattoo artist or a dermatologist to determine the best ointment for your specific needs.
Are there specific oils that promote faster and better tattoo healing?
While there are many oils that claim to promote faster and better tattoo healing, there is limited scientific evidence to support these claims. We recommend sticking to recommended ointments and moisturizers and avoiding any oils or products that have not been specifically recommended by a trusted professional.
